Welcome to the Pixelforge render team. Known issue: the thumbnail image cache in Glimmerbox leaks roughly 40 MB per hour under sustained load. Root cause is evicted entries keeping decoded bitmaps pinned via the preview layer. Mitigation: restart the cache worker nightly until the refactor lands. Do not raise the cache ceiling; it only delays the crash. Full diagnosis notes and the fix roadmap are on the internal page below.

wiki page, bagaf-fawip: https://harbor.tolvaqsys.local/pages/repo/pages/secrets/eac969ffc71f356b

Changelog 2.9 — Lodebranch API defaults

Fixed the N+1 pattern on nested author lookups by batching through the new Tarnwick dataloader. Batching is now on by default; the per-request loader cache is enabled and scoped correctly. Reviewers: the old eager-resolve flag is removed, so reject any diff reintroducing it. The loader ships with the following default configuration.

config for kafof-bawef:
holath:
  log_level: debug
  metrics_host: metrics.holath.qorvelsys.internal
  pin: 2191
  pool_size: 32

UserSplit Cutover Drift: the extracted account service and the legacy Marigold monolith user module are reporting divergent record counts during dual-write. This fires when drift exceeds 0.5% over 15 minutes. New team members should not replay writes manually. Reconciliation steps and the rollback procedure are documented on the internal page.

wiki page, tajog-fafog: https://gitlab.paliqsys.corp/dash/display/job/853dd6fcbf54

Dear Board Members,

We have received the revised term sheet from Quennell Partners regarding the proposed minority investment in our Bridgehollow logistics unit. Valuation lands at the upper end of our internal range, but the governance provisions grant Quennell a veto on capital expenditure above a defined threshold, which counsel views as unusually broad. Management recommends a structured counter before Friday's deadline. For full context, please review the confidential note appended directly below.

confidential, bahof-yaweg: Headcount on the Kaseth team goes from 32 to 109 by the end of January. Gross margin on Kaseth came in at 46 percent against a plan of 45 percent.